Leading companies use the same courses to help employees keep their skills fresh. Get unlimited access to 19,000+ of Udemy’s top … WebList vs. base price. Instructors set a base price for each course, which is used as the course's list price for instructors who are not opted into the Udemy Deals Program. For instructors who opt in to the Udemy Deals Program, Udemy may generate and display a market-specific list price that is different from the base price (except in Japan). how to check for inverse functions
